问题描述
我正在使用Ionic和Angular开发移动应用程序 离子性:
Ionic Framework : @ionic/angular 5.0.7
@angular-devkit/build-angular : 0.803.26
@angular-devkit/schematics : 8.3.26
@angular/cli : 8.3.26
@ionic/angular-toolkit : 2.2.0
Cordova:
Cordova CLI : 10.0.0
Cordova Platforms : android 8.1.0
Cordova Plugins : cordova-plugin-ionic-keyboard 2.2.0,cordova-plugin-ionic-webview 4.2.1,(and 7 other plugins)
Utility:
cordova-res (update available: 0.14.0) : 0.10.0
native-run (update available: 1.0.0) : 0.3.0
System:
Android SDK Tools : 26.1.1 (C:\Android\sdk)
NodeJS : v14.2.0 (C:\Program Files\nodejs\node.exe)
npm : 6.14.4
OS : Windows 10
我正在使用IBM Cloud App ID单页应用程序认证,并遵循以下指南:
- https://www.npmjs.com/package/ibmcloud-appid-js
- https://www.ibm.com/cloud/blog/secure-your-single-page-angular-apps-using-app-id
SPA身份验证将打开一个弹出窗口,以允许用户键入凭据。 由于我正在运行设备应用程序(不是Web),因此弹出窗口无法打开,并且出现错误:“无法打开弹出窗口”。
是否可以让设备打开弹出窗口?当在设备中的浏览器中运行应用程序时,它运行良好。 该应用程序必须在设备上运行,因为它使用设备摄像头读取QRCode。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)